About 1,3-benzothiazol-2-ylmethyl 3-(carbamoylamino)-3-(2-chlorophenyl)propanoate
1,3-benzothiazol-2-ylmethyl 3-(carbamoylamino)-3-(2-chlorophenyl)propanoate (PubChem CID 42899546) has the molecular formula C18H16ClN3O3S
and a molecular weight of 389.86 g/mol. Its IUPAC name is 1,3-benzothiazol-2-ylmethyl 3-(carbamoylamino)-3-(2-chlorophenyl)propanoate.

What is the SMILES notation for 1,3-benzothiazol-2-ylmethyl 3-(carbamoylamino)-3-(2-chlorophenyl)propanoate?
The canonical SMILES for 1,3-benzothiazol-2-ylmethyl 3-(carbamoylamino)-3-(2-chlorophenyl)propanoate is NC(=O)NC(CC(=O)OCc1nc2ccccc2s1)c1ccccc1Cl.
What is the InChIKey of 1,3-benzothiazol-2-ylmethyl 3-(carbamoylamino)-3-(2-chlorophenyl)propanoate?
The InChIKey is VMCAFVNDXGUKNB-UHFFFAOYSA-N. The full InChI is InChI=1S/C18H16ClN3O3S/c19-12-6-2-1-5-11(12)14(22-18(20)24)9-17(23)25-10-16-21-13-7-3-4-8-15(13)26-16/h1-8,14H,9-10H2,(H3,20,22,24).
What are the key properties of 1,3-benzothiazol-2-ylmethyl 3-(carbamoylamino)-3-(2-chlorophenyl)propanoate?
1,3-benzothiazol-2-ylmethyl 3-(carbamoylamino)-3-(2-chlorophenyl)propanoate has a molecular weight of 389.86 g/mol, XLogP of 3.79, 6 rotatable bonds, 2 hydrogen bond donors, and 5 hydrogen bond acceptors.
